About Beastieball

Coach a sports team of Beasties in this turn-based volleyball RPG!

Beasties' teamwork is powered up by the relationships they form together. Whether they become BESTIES, PARTNERS, RIVALS or SWEETHEARTS they'll get a powerful combo move that's unique to every pair and can turn the tide in a tough match!

Explore an open world and meet a varied cast of Ranked coaches, each with their own story. You'll have to defeat them and raise your ranking if you want to compete in the CROWN SERIES.

Bosses are all revealed on your map from the start and can be defeated in any order. With each one you defeat, the others become stronger, so no matter which way you go you'll have a tough and exciting rise to the top.

Play sports in strategic turn-based encounters on a tiny tactics grid. When you have the ball, you have multiple actions to pass and set up a devastating attack. When the other team has the ball, you'll have to anticipate their attack and make a defense play.

Every Beastie has unique traits, strengths and weaknesses and they have many ways to work together, lending a great deal of depth and strategy to every match.
There's more to making it in the Beastieball League than playing sports! Ranked coaches you defeat become available to hang out, allowing you to build your friendship and see extra story.As the plot unfolds you'll meet friends, rivals, corporate sponsors, and even a mysterious Sports King with grand ambitions...

I wasn't going to leave this review, but I feel like I have to. This is more of a warning than a negative review. When you have the option to loan away your beastie for training to a man named Gene? Don't do it. This is a game with one save. No save slots. It'll permanently ruin your save, and you won't realise it until much later. And when you do? Your only option is to start over. It's worse because the NPC in question says that if you don't accept, they'll retract their offer forever. So you feel pressured into doing it. Essentially, you're pressured into wrecking your save. Your one save. In a dialogue that doesn't give you a chance to 'back out and think about it' so you can make a backup of your save. So, it's up to you whether you heed me on this, but do so at your peril. You will lose your progress from the very beginning. For me, it ruined my experience with the game as I rushed ahead trying to figure out how to fix the bug—attempting different things that were suggested. So, what might've been fun discoveries are now stressful memories. I don't want to happen to anyone else playing this. This isn't a bad game. It's a great game with a wretched design decision tied to …
